## Deployment

ReceiptWren, our donation-receipt mailer, deploys from the `stable` branch via the Quillgate pipeline. Before promoting a build, confirm the template bundle version matches what the Harbrook finance team signed off on, since receipts are legally sensitive. Run the dry-run mailer against the sandbox donor list and inspect at least three rendered PDFs. Rollbacks must restore both the binary and the template bundle together; mismatched pairs produce blank totals. The environment expects the following configuration values at startup.

settings of tawif-tafog:
[oliox]
port = 7000
team = pelius
host = oliox.plorvaforge.corp
region = upper-2
access_code = ac_48b9f0
timeout_ms = 3000

Re: Insurance renewal with Thornbeck Mutual

The group policy covering all twelve branches renews at the end of next month. Thornbeck's indicative quote carries a 6% premium increase, largely reflecting last year's flood claim at the Merrowgate branch. I have requested revised terms excluding the disputed equipment rider. Branch managers should confirm asset registers by the 20th so the schedule is accurate. The commercial reasoning behind our renewal position is set out in the note that follows.

board note of baweg-bawig: Project Tamath slips by six weeks because of the audit delay.

## Partner SFTP Drop — Marlowe Freight

Files land nightly between 02:00–03:30 UTC in the inbound drop. Watcher job `marlowe-ingest` picks them up; if nothing arrives by 04:00, the Quillhook alert fires. Do NOT re-request files from Marlowe before checking the quarantine folder — malformed headers get parked there silently. Retries are safe; ingest is idempotent on file checksum. Rotation of the drop credentials is quarterly, owned by platform. Full escalation steps and contacts are on the runbook page.

dashboard of taduf-tahof = https://confluence.tolvaqlabs.internal/browse/browse/display/f01240ca